    How to mark threads SOLVED?

    With this new format, How do you mark a thread as being solved?

    Re: How to mark threads

    Moved to Forum Feedback and Help

    The plugin that provided this function is unfortunately not compatible with vBulletin 4. We are looking to replace this as soon as we can, but this may be some time yet. In the meantime, a workaround would be:

    Go to the first post in your thread. Click on "Edit Post". Now click on the orange "Go Advanced" button. In the advanced editor change the prefix to "SOLVED". Now click on the orange "Save Changes" button.

    Please note that there is a 7-day 60-day limit on being able to edit posts, and this would include changing the prefix.

    EDIT: I've extended the edit time to 60 days. We'll review that again once we have a workable plugin in place.
